Fort Myers, Fl — The CVCO55CXT-6250-6250 coaxial resonator oscillator (CRO) from Crystek employs frequency doubling, 2X fundamental technology to reach new performance levels of lower phase noise and much lower harmonics over the competition, while achieving lower current consumption in the process.
This coaxial VCO operates at 6250 MHz with a tuning voltage range of 0.5 Vdc to 4.5 Vdc. It features a typical phase noise of -100 dBc/Hz at 10 kHz offset and has good linearity.
The CRO exhibits an output power of 0.0 dBm typical into a 50 ohm load with a supply of +8.0 Vdc and a typical current consumption of 25 mA. Pushing and pulling are both minimized to 1.5 MHz/V and 0.5 MHz, respectively. Second harmonic suppression is -30 dBc typical. The coaxial resonator oscillator is packaged in the industry-standard 1.27- x 1.27-mm (0.5- x 0.5-inch) package.
Typical applications include digital radio equipment, fixed wireless access, satellite communications systems, and base stations.
